One of the criticisms we hear often is that the United States, particulary during the Bush years (nightmare), does not listen to or respect international opinion.

Many argue that the USA, particularly during the Bush years, acts very paranoid, as if the world is out to get us. On the other hand, the international community feels that the USA blatantly disregards "their" opinions and advice and does what ever it pleases.

Do you think the United States has an inherent obligation to consider the views of the international community and to respect their opinions, advice and guidance if it is not a direct and blatant threat to us?
